Output 3def7cdfaeae14ef4fbed4abcf9a6fdad433ea730694b919f7c0a9158f848e24:1

value
39608194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6ea1a5e0eb6e088bc9682aeb8df25fd296ab9c OP_EQUAL
address
3QcU4VxyhAGbodPdQWQxHHWPRvQZYxXbef
transaction
3def7cdfaeae14ef4fbed4abcf9a6fdad433ea730694b919f7c0a9158f848e24
spent
true